Interior Decoration and Interior Design

Many people mistake interior decoration for interior design. The primary distinction between the two is the amount of education required. Any person can do business as an interior decorator if they possess a basic knowledge of or a talent for decorating interior spaces. On the other hand, doing business as an interior designer necessitates a formal education and in numerous states one must have an accredited Associate or Bachelor's Degree as well as be licensed. Interior designers are educated to make living or work spaces attractive as well as functional. On many projects they may team up with architects and building engineers. There are two broad areas that an interior designer in Rubidoux CA may specialize in:

  • Residential Designing. Interior Designers often work on existing homes as well as new construction. They can design basically any room of a house, including bedrooms, basements and closets. Or they can specialize in designing one specific room, for instance kitchens or bathrooms.
  • Commercial Design. When working on public or commercial areas, designers frequently focus primarily on either functionality or aesthetic appeal but take notice of both. As an example, business meeting rooms and reception areas are areas where aesthetics may be emphasized over function. Designs for hospitals and banks might concentrate more on functionality over looks as the primary consideration.

There are numerous areas of residential and commercial interior design that a designer must learn, including lighting, color schemes, furniture and acoustics. They have to be able to read blue prints and use graphic design in order to create their visions. From selecting carpeting and wall paper to integrating Feng shui principles, Rubidoux California interior designers implement a wide variety of skills that contribute to their final designs.
 

Interior Designer Degree Programs

There are four degree alternatives available in interior design to obtain the training necessary to begin your new profession in Rubidoux CA. Your selection will undoubtedly be influenced by your career objectives in addition to the money and time that you have to invest in your education. But regardless of which degree program you opt to enroll in, make certain to choose one that is accredited. Accreditation is mandated in order to take the National Council for Interior Design Qualification (NCIDQ) examination required in several states. More will be covered on additional accreditation benefits later. Following are brief explanations of the interior design degrees that are available.

  • Associate Degree. Associate degrees in interior design furnish the minimum level of training needed to enter the field. They take roughly 2 years to finish and programs are available at many California community colleges and vocational schools. Graduates can usually obtain entry level employment as design assistants.
  • Bachelor's Degree. Bachelor's degrees are four year programs that furnish more extensive training than the Associate Degree. They deal with the creative and technical components of the trade required to become a designer. They are the minimum credential needed by a college graduate in order to secure an entry level position as an interior designer.
  • Master's Degree. These two year programs provide advanced design training after achieving the Bachelor's Degree. Master's Degrees provide options in specialty majors in general areas such as business offices or residential bathrooms. A number of students enroll to enhance their skills to be more competitive in their careers.
  • Doctorate Degree. Doctorate programs are primarily for those professionals who want to teach interior design at a university or college level. The programs differ in length but are typically completed in 3 to 5 years.

To work as a professional and adopt the title of "Interior Designer", a number of states mandate that graduates of accredited colleges become licensed. In some instances, 2 or more years of professional experience may be needed before an applicant can take the licensing examination.

Is the Interior Design College Accredited? It's imperative to make sure that the interior designer college and program that you enroll in has been accredited by either a national or regional organization. One of the most highly regarded in the field is the National Association of Schools of Art and Design (NASAD). Colleges earning accreditation from the NASAD have undergone an extensive evaluation of their programs and instructors. Just verify that both the college and the degree program have been accredited by a U.S. Department of Education recognized accrediting agency. Not only will it help confirm that the reputation of the college and the quality of the training are outstanding, it might also help when obtaining financial assistance or a student loan. Often they are not accessible for non-accredited colleges. Also, a number of Rubidoux California employers will only employ graduates of accredited colleges for entry level positions.

Does the School Ready you for Licensing? As we mentioned earlier, some States do require that interior designers become licensed. This would require a passing score on the National Council for Interior Design Qualification (NCIDQ) exam in addition to a degree from an accredited program. And in some of those States mandating licensing, two or more years of professional experience may be required also. So besides furnishing an excellent education, the Rubidoux CA program you enroll in should also provide the appropriate education to pass the NCIDQ examination and satisfy the minimum licensing requirements for California or the State where you will be working.
